8 . 四棱锥S-ABCD中,侧面SAD是正三角形,底面ABCD是正方形,且平面SAD⊥平面ABCD,M、N分别是AB、SC的中点.
(Ⅰ)求证:MN∥平面SAD;
(Ⅱ)求二面角S-CM-D的余弦值.
